Enquiry or Inquiry? - Grammar Monster Inquiry and enquiry are interchangeable in the US, but inquiry dominates to the extent that most Americans consider enquiry a spelling mistake In the UK, inquiry and enquiry are interchangeable, but inquiry is usually used for a formal investigation
Inquiry - Wikipedia An inquiry (also spelled as enquiry in British English) [a][b] is any process that has the aim of augmenting knowledge, resolving doubt, or solving a problem A theory of inquiry is an account of the various types of inquiry and a treatment of the ways that each type of inquiry achieves its aim
